    Police Crack Down on Crime: Illegal Weapons Factory Raided

    The Nigeria Police Force has made significant breakthroughs in its efforts to combat crime and ensure national safety.

    In a series of coordinated operations, the police raided an illegal weapons manufacturing factory in Benue State, arrested a notorious cultist in Delta State, and apprehended two murder suspects in Kebbi State.

    Illegal Weapons Factory Raided

    On January 11, 2025, police operatives raided an illegal weapons manufacturing factory in Tse Akamabe Area of Kwande LGA, Benue State.

    The operation resulted in the arrest of two suspects, Friday Aduduakambe and Iorwashima Iornyume. A search of the factory yielded a cache of illicit weapons and manufacturing tools, including:

    9 locally fabricated pistols

    1 locally fabricated Ak47 riffle (unfinished)

    2 gas cylinders

    4 vise machines

    1 filing machine

    Numerous other weapons manufacturing tools

    Notorious Cultist Arrested

    In a separate operation, police operatives in Delta State arrested a notorious cultist, Prosper Akeni, and recovered a stash of firearms and ammunition.

    The suspect confessed that the recovered guns belonged to his cult group and that he was the group’s leader.

    Murder Suspects Arrested

    In Kebbi State, police operatives arrested two suspects, Yunusa Haruna and Abubakar Ummar, for murder.

    Haruna allegedly stabbed his elder brother, Isiyaku Haruna, to death, while Ummar was arrested for stabbing one Mohammed Bala during an argument.

    IGP Commends Operatives

    The Inspector-General of Police, IGP Kayode Adeolu Egbetokun, commended the operatives for their achievements and urged them to intensify efforts to restore sanctity across the country.

    The IGP also encouraged the public to remain vigilant and share useful information with the police to ensure a community-based policing system.
